Description

Freddy and F.M. have to navigate jealous feelings about new friendships while an imp causes trouble for them at the palace!

Freddy has made his first new friend at school, and F.M. feels a little insecure about Freddy bringing him for a sleepover. Meanwhile, Freddy feels jealous that F.M.'s friend Binsa is hired as his dad's lab assistant, since he thinks he should be the only one helping his dad out. Can they learn to all work together to help Freddy and his friend when they're trapped below the palace by the imp?

About the Author

Cort Lane is a producer, creative exec, and storyteller with two decades of kids' television experience at Marvel/Disney and Mattel. He has credits on over 50 productions, two Emmy nominations, and two NAACP Image Nominations. He currently serves on GLAAD's Kids and Family Advisory Council, and is working on the new My Little Pony series on Netflix. He currently lives in Los Angeles, California.

Ankitha Kini is an animator, comics artist, and illustrator. She loves stories steeped in culture and history. A mix of whimsy, fact, and fantasy brings life to her creature-filled world. When she's not drawing, she likes to travel and to make friends with stray cats. She studied Animation Film Design at NID in Ahmedabad, India, and now lives in Bengaluru.
